From Wired News, about Microsofts relaunch (again!) of Windows CE, now known
as the Pocket PC:
http://www.wired.com/news/technology/0,1282,35734,00.html
"Pocket PCs will come with smaller "pocket" versions of popular Microsoft
software, such as Word, Excel, and Outlook, as well as Microsoft Reader
software for displaying e-books, Windows Media Player for audio and video,
and Internet Explorer."
Can you imagine a palmtop running Word, Excel, Outlook, Windows Media Player
and IE? Even slimmed down versions? *cringe*
